Scuba diving is an equipment intensive activity, requiring significant capital outlay to establish a retail outlet with the expected range of equipment and filling facilities. Dive boats are a large capital expense, with high running costs. There are also health and safety aspects for the operator and the customer.

In the recreational scuba diving industry, a liveaboard service offers its guests the opportunity to stay aboard for one or more nights, unlike a day boat operation. This allows time to travel to more distant dive sites. Normally, a liveaboard charter caters for between about ten and thirty passengers. [4]
